How much biotin Should a 60 year old woman take?

There’s no recommended dietary allowance for biotin. Typically, adequate intakes are defined as 30 micrograms (mcg) for adults and pregnant women and 35 mcg for breastfeeding women. For a biotin deficiency, a dose of up to 10 milligrams (mg) a day has been used, with the guidance of a trained health professional.

How much vitamin d3 should I take daily?

All things considered, a daily vitamin D intake of 1,000–4,000 IU, or 25–100 micrograms, should be enough to ensure optimal blood levels in most people. According to the National Institutes of Health, the safe upper limit is 4,000 IU.

Is mcg bigger or mg bigger?

One milligram is one thousandth of a gram and one thousand micrograms. A milligram is generally abbreviated as mg. One microgram is one millionth of a gram and one thousandth of a milligram. It is usually abbreviated as mcg or ug.

Should I take 500 mcg or 1000 mcg B12?

In one 8-week study in 100 older adults, supplementing with 500 mcg of vitamin B12 were found to normalize B12 levels in 90% of participants. Higher doses of up to 1,000 mcg (1 mg) may be necessary for some ( 10 ).

Is 1000 mcg of vitamin B12 good?

The amount of vitamin B12 in supplements varies widely. Some provide doses of vitamin B12 that are much higher than recommended amounts, such as 500 mcg or 1,000 mcg, but your body absorbs only a small percentage of it. These doses are considered safe.

Is 1000 mcg biotin too much?

What’s the Maximum Safe Dose of Biotin? The Mayo Clinic states that no side effects have been reported for biotin in amounts of up to 10 milligrams (10,000 mcg) per day. This is double the amount of biotin that’s included in our biotin gummy vitamins.
